Posting Summary Rutgers, the State University of New Jersey, is seeking a Medical Office Assistant for the Psychiatry Department within New Jersey Medical School.

Among the key duties of the position are the following:  Organizes and maintains a filing system for patient charts, including generating new charts, filing, and pulling charts.  Answers telephones and either responds to inquiry, directs caller to appropriate personnel, or transcribes messages for a return call from other staff. Schedules appointments and enters appointment date and time into computerized scheduler.  Registers patients by verifying that patient’s record is up to date and accurate.  Makes appropriate demographic and insurance changes in computer system and on patient’s chart.  Coordinates referrals for patients through insurance and other physician offices.  Position Status Full Time Hours Per Week Daily Work Shift Day Work Arrangement Consistent with the current application of Rutgers Policy 60.3.22 or the applicable provisions of relevant collective negotiations agreements, this position may be eligible for a hybrid work arrangement.
